I have seen before and after dynos of the HRC kit, and all the difference is in the mid to top end. No real changes on the low end. Low end is strong on the Honda anyway (at least compared to the Yamaha), but Honda tames it down with tall gearing, no doubt specified by their lawyers who don't want to see somebody wheelie the thing right out from underneath themselves! How are you liking it with the 13t? Doesn't make it wheelie to easy, does it?
I have the 13t for when I trail ride. It doesn't make it wheelie any more than the 14t. Makes it much better for tight and techincal trails. Going to the dunes I switch back to the 14t. This month I'm going to try a 14/37 combo at Florence.

I have a stage II hotcam, rejeted and open air box and 2" end cap. Pretty much the same setup as the HRC kit. I feel the cam mod made a real difference in the top end hit. I love it.
